Green Onion Alfredo
Delicious pasta recipe. You will need to prepare the sauce a day in advance to allow the flavors to marinade together for optimal flavor.
Cooking Instructions
- 1
Grate cheese if not already grated
- 2
Mix heavy whipping cream, cheese, and spices together in a mixing bowl. Allow this mixture to sit in the fridge, covered, for at least 24 hours for optional flavor.
- 3
Chop scallions
- 4
Chop fresh parsley. *note: I like to prep the parsley and chives in advance along with the sauce mixture so there isn't as much work to do the next day when having this for dinner.
- 5
Cook chicken or shrimp. (I'm not really a shrimp guy so chicken is used in this example) I like to use salt and Italian seasoning. I like to use an air fryer to cook my chicken.
- 6
Cook pasta while chicken or shrimp is cooking
- 7
Cut chicken into bite size pieces
- 8
Use approximately ½ cup of sauce mixture per serving. Add sauce mixture, a few pieces of chicken or shrimp and handfuls of parsley and chives to a pan and turn the heat on high
- 9
Heat, stirring frequently, until sauce is bubbling in the middle as well as the outsides.
- 10
Add an appropriate amount of pasta for the number of servings of sauce and mix well.
- 11
Heat until the noodles are well-coated with sauce and serve
